SUBJECT:

Award of Bid No. F0201-61 for Modification of the Traffic Signal at Wolfe Road/Old San Francisco Road (RTC#03-085)

REPORT IN BRIEF

Approval is requested for the award of a contract to Brown and Fesler, Inc., of San Ramon to modify the traffic signal at the Wolfe Road/Old San Francisco Road intersection for the Department of Public Works Project Administration Division (Project #TR-01/03-03).

BACKGROUND

The traffic signal at Wolfe Road and Old San Francisco Road/Reed Avenue was originally constructed in 1976 and was later modified in 1982 to add new traffic signal poles on Old San Francisco/Reed. Staff has now encountered several problems with the existing conduit structures and control equipment. Several conductors have failed due to aging, and all existing spare wires have been used. The traffic signal controller cabinet is no longer moisture proof and shows signs of water-related damage. In addition, the traffic signal controller is incompatible with other City equipment and cannot communicate with other equipment along the Wolfe Road corridor. Staff has determined that this intersection should be reconstructed to bring all control equipment, conduits and poles up to current standards.

DISCUSSION

Bid specifications were prepared by Public Works and Purchasing Staff. The Notice Inviting Bids was published in The Sun on February 5, 2003. The bid package was distributed to Bay Area Builders Exchanges and broadcast to potential contractors through the DemandStar by Onvia public procurement network. Sixteen contractors requested bid documents. Sealed bids were publicly opened on February 26, 2003.

 Four responsive bids were received.

Bidder

Total Bid

Engineer's Estimate

$168,000

Brown & Fesler, Inc., of San Ramon

$168,036

Tennyson Electric, Inc., of Livermore

$189,491

Mike Brown Electric Co., Inc, of Cotati

$209,665

Steve Lacki Electric Construction of Capitola

$211,500

Staff recommends acceptance of the bid from Brown & Fesler, Inc., the lowest responsive and responsible bidder.

A determination was made that this project will have no significant effect on the environment in accordance with CEQA guidelines for categorically exempt projects.

FISCAL IMPACT

Projects costs include:

Construction

$168,036

Contingency (15% of construction cost)

$ 25,205

Total cost

$193,241

Funds are available in the Infrastructure Renovation and Replacement Fund. General Fund Assets Sub-Fund, budgeted in Project #820190 - Traffic Signal Underground Replacement.

RECOMMENDATION

It is recommended that Council:

  1. Award a contract in the amount of $168,036 to Brown & Fesler, Inc., for the Wolfe Road/Old San Francisco Road Signal Modification Project; and
  2. Authorize a contingency in the amount of $25,205.
